Description:
Put the Internet to work for your business with this guide to the Net for business managers and owners. Doing More Business on the Internet improves your communications with customers by teaching you how to inform people, answer their questions, and respond to suggestions. Author Mary Cronin gathered her information for this book from more than 60 businesses, ranging from America's largest corporations to one-person enterprises. Cronin describes how to establish a global presence, improve customer support and service, identify and explore new markets, and tap into the vast resources of interactive networks to boost productivity and encourage innovation within your organization.
